Which type of nebula is characterized by a high density of dust that blocks light?

The correct response identifies a dark nebula, which is characterized by its high density of dust and gas that effectively blocks light from objects behind it. In contrast to other types of nebulae, dark nebulae do not emit light or reflect it; therefore, they appear as dark patches against the brighter background of stars and other astronomical features. This opacity is primarily due to the thick concentration of interstellar dust particles, which absorb and scatter light, preventing it from passing through.

Other types of nebulae, like bright nebulae or emission nebulae, are typically involved in light emission due to ionized gas, while planetary nebulae usually display bright, glowing shells around dying stars. In summary, the defining characteristic of dark nebulae is their ability to obscure light, which is a critical feature that sets them apart from other nebula categories.
